Are there any restrictions on what games I can play with the no deposit bonus?

Yes, there are usually restrictions. The bonus may only be used on certain games, such as slots, and not on table games like blackjack or roulette. Some games may contribute less toward meeting wagering requirements. For example, slots might count 100%, while table games could count only 10%. Always review the bonus terms to know which games are allowed and how they affect your ability to withdraw winnings.

What happens if I win money using the no deposit bonus?

If you win money while using the no deposit bonus, you can keep the winnings, but only after meeting the wagering conditions. These conditions mean you must play through the bonus amount a certain number of times before you can withdraw. For example, if you get $10 with a 30x wagering requirement, you must bet $300 before you can cash out. Withdrawals are also limited to a maximum amount, which is usually stated in the bonus rules.
